Jiarui Hou is a robotics researcher whose work centers on intelligent automation and autonomous navigation systems, with a particular focus on the practical deployment of robotic solutions in industrial settings. Hou’s most-cited paper, "Development of ROS-Based Laser Navigation Forklift AGV System" (2022), exemplifies this focus by detailing the integration of the Robot Operating System (ROS) with laser-based navigation to create a cost-effective, reliable automated guided vehicle (AGV) for material handling. This work, which has garnered 4 citations, addresses a critical challenge in logistics and manufacturing: enabling forklifts to navigate dynamic environments without fixed infrastructure. By leveraging ROS’s modular architecture, Hou’s system demonstrates how open-source robotics frameworks can accelerate the development of industrial automation, reducing both cost and complexity.
